The team

In the Engine management System Software group we deliver the complete software for the Engine and Aftertreatment Control, which is one of Scania's most advanced real-time control system. Therefore the group is as well responsible for the complete engine and aftertreatment management systems. This includes system ownership, configuration management, iteration lead and release management.

The Engine management System Software group works strongly cross-functional by coordinating many different groups likewise for software development and testing during the development phase as well as with for production at the turning point from development phase into series production.

Beside that we are currently facing exciting challenges in delivering our Engine and Aftertreatment control system to several brands and companies within the whole Traton Group that are based in Sweden, Germany and the U.S. The development and improvements we are doing to our systems have an extremely large positive impact on the global environment over the next few decades.

Your role

As a member of the system manager / system owner team, you are responsible for one or more of our control system variants. This means you will have an overall control and responsibility of what is developed and delivered into the system to each corresponding software release.

For that you will follow up that internal and external requirements are handled by different groups and oversees the system roadmap to meet future challenges and needs.

As a system manager / system owner, you ensure that development of the system is carried out correctly and that the system can be described in an overall way for various stakeholders inside and outside Scania to enable production and service. As well will it be part of the system owner role to coordinate and follow up on software and calibration deliveries to each dedicated software release, construct the software files and deliver them to corresponding parts within Traton and handle deviations in the deliveries together with the project management and development groups.
